2009 WSOP News Page from Full Tilt Poker
The hugely successful poker site Full Tilt is upping the ante on the news from 2009 WSOP in Vegas with their 2009 World Series of Poker Coverage Page, a new portal dedicated to provide customers on everything related to the World Series of Poker in Las Vegas, including players views, players’ insights, players’ coverage, round the clock news, poker players’ blogs and more.
FullTilt.com’s new 2009 WSOP Coverage Page is not the typical news portal offered by many other sites. The site is broken down into three areas, and includes a daily highlights part in where viewers can get access to the World Series of Poker 2009 events info, results, players and more in an articles series written by the FullTilt.com poker experts Roy Winston and AlCantHang. Aside from the typical daily updates and results on all of the poker event, Full Tilt’s 2009 WSOP News Page also highlights two blogs, Poker from the Rail Blog, which highlights comments, wsop news, insider info from FullTiltPoker.com Professionals, comments from FullTilt.com’s viewers and authors and guest posts from other poker bloggers, and the Pro Blog, which highlights commentaries from members of Team Full Tilt playing in the World Series of Poker in Las Vegas, including Andy Bloch, Jon “Pearljammed” Turner and Roy Winston.
In addition, FullTiltPoker.com’s new World Series of Poker Coverage Page has a Twitter section that supplies live updates and commentary from different poker pros. Included in the Twitter section include, Beth Shak, Jennifer Harman, Andy Bloch, Howard Lederer, Mike Matusow and Rafe Furst. The Twitter section allows players to send short messages allowing people from around the world to stay informed. These comments known as “tweets”, can be forwarded from all over through a cellular phone or other handheld.
